在机场的边界隔离网传感器,一旦有人靠近,监控室的网络就立刻显示“有入侵倾向”;有人攀爬,显示“一级入侵”;继续攀爬,显示“二级入侵”;爬到最高处,则发出“三级入侵”警告。这是中科院无锡高新微纳传感网工程技术研发中心进行的物联网技术演示。前不久,上海世博会与该中心签下首份订单,购买1500万元的防入侵微纳传感网产品。传感网又称物联网,指的是将各种信息传感设备,如射频识别(RFID)装置、红外感应器、全球定位系统、激光扫描器等种种装置与互联网结合起来而形成的一个巨大网络。其目的,是让所有的物品都与网络连接在一起,方便识别和管理。据介绍,物联网是信息技术的前沿和交叉领域。继计算机、互联网与移动通信网之后,物联网掀起了世界信息产业新浪潮,近来受到业界的广泛关注。
Isolate the network sensor at the airport boundary, and once someone is near, the monitoring room’s network immediately shows “Intrusion Tendency”; someone climbs to show “Level 1 Intrusion”; continue climbing to show “Level 2 intrusion ”; Climbed to the top, then issued “ three invasion ”warning. This is the IOT technology demonstration conducted by Wuxi Hi-tech Micro-nano Sensor Network Engineering Technology Research and Development Center. Not long ago, the Shanghai World Expo and the center signed the first order to buy 15 million yuan of anti-invasive micro-nano sensor network products. Sensor network, also known as Internet of Things, refers to a variety of information sensing devices, such as radio frequency identification (RFID) devices, infrared sensors, global positioning systems, laser scanners and other devices combined with the Internet to form a huge The internet. Its purpose is to have all the items connected to the Internet for easy identification and management. According to reports, the Internet of things is the forefront of information technology and cross-cutting areas. Following the computer, Internet and mobile communication networks, the Internet of Things has set off a new wave of the world’s information industry and has drawn wide attention from the industry recently.
